This market resolves YES if Joe Manchin utters a specific term, such as "Socialism / Socialist," during the "Fox News: One Nation with Brian Kilmeade" program. A NO resolution is triggered if he does not say the specified term during the broadcast. The maximum payout date for this market is listed as September 7, 2026, and no other specific deadlines or special settlement conditions are explicitly detailed.

Market Discussion
In an archived appearance on Fox News' 'One Nation with Brian Kilmeade' on August 23, 2026, Joe Manchin warned that an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ez presidency would be 'devastating' and criticized progressive environmental policies and the national debt [^]. Manchin is also active in political commentary through his Independent Leadership Council, advocating for independent candidates and structural election reforms while criticizing 'extremes' in both parties [^]. However, as of August 24, 2026, there is no public record or scheduled announcement indicating his appearance on the show [^].

8. How has Joe Manchin's public rhetoric regarding Donald Trump and the national Democratic Party evolved since his 2024 retirement announcement?
| Democratic Party Criticism | Described as "toxic," "rudderless," and influenced by progressive "extremes" and social issues [^][^][^][^] |
|---|---|
| Stance on Donald Trump | Expressed a desire for Donald Trump to succeed, emphasizing a duty to support the president [^][^][^] |
| Relationship with Trump | Stated he gets "along fine" with Donald Trump [^][^][^] |
